 Cut on gold 250gsm Mirri, on the Zing.





The card base measures 7 1/2 by 8 1/4 inch to give you an idea of size. And its Super Gold by Anna Marie Designs.
 So First the Alium I designed and is available as an MTC file on MTC. Then the little plaque bottom Right, were cut twice on the Zing, force 120,
next it was matted onto some Black "Chocolate" card again Anna Marie Designs, then some gold coated brown paper from Payper Box.
The next layer is actually the remains of the backing sheet from a pack of cheap craft goodies from my local Pound shop!
 The ribbon is a luxurious double-sided Gold/chocolate brown from Ribbon box, a special on the run up to Christmas last year, very heavy!
I cut the flowers again on the gold coated Brown paper, rolled, and hot-glue gunned with a gem in the centre of each flower.
Finally, I used a small stamp from the boys at Kraftyhands. from the Hibiscus Stampography set designed by the fab Ian Campbell. Its a set of clear stamps, with some butterflies, a Hibiscus obviously, and some lovely fonts. I simply stamped it in Stazon, black.
